"Fantastic Staff and Care"

About: Royal Primary Care

I've been with Royal Primary Care Chesterfield since a young child and I have always been treat with great care and respect by all members off staff including receptionists both at the Grange and over the phone.

I would love to thank everyone who has seen me over the years but with particular thanks to the member of staff who I have seen twice for blood tests. I find them frightening, I get very emotional and it takes me a lot of time to work up the courage to have them done.

She is always very respectful of how I feel, patient with me and makes the environment comfortable. I usually feel embarrassed and silly but she makes sure that I don't feel that way. It means a lot.

My GP saw me in Sep and was very thorough with me and knowledgeable. He set the ball rolling looking into issues that I've had for a while and is easy to talk to. I left feeling a lot more understanding of my symptoms.

One member of staff who I last saw in Sep was absolutely brilliant! I came to her with a small bundle of problems and she was particularly great listening to me and trying to help with a mental health issue. All whilst having a trainee with her.

But as I mentioned, all GPS and other staff I've seen have been consistently great. Long waiting times and difficulty booking appointments are more of a reflection on how much strain is on our health services because the people are fantastic. Thank you.
